Use HTTPS

Using HTTPS is crucial for SEO success, offering various benefits in website ranking and user trust. First off, search engines like Google prioritize secure websites, boosting their visibility in search results. This not only improves organic traffic but also establishes credibility, as users are more likely to engage with secure sites. HTTPS encrypts data transmission, keeping user information safe and creating a secure online environment. In the competitive SEO landscape of 2024, HTTPS is a crucial ranking factor that positively influences search algorithms. Additionally, with increasing concerns about cyber threats, HTTPS reassures visitors, reducing bounce rates, and improving dwell time. In summary, adopting HTTPS aligns with SEO best practices and ensures a safer and more trustworthy digital experience, significantly contributing to the overall success of a website in 2024.

Website Consistency

Maintain a singular online identity by enforcing a preferred domain (e.g., www or non-www) through 301 redirects. Implement canonical tags in your HTML to communicate the primary version of each page to search engines, preventing duplicate content issues. Regularly update your robots.txt file to guide crawlers, and use hreflang tags for multilingual sites. Check for duplicate content and monitor with tools like Google Search Console for insights. Consistency in URL structure and 301 redirects help streamline user experience and bolster SEO, ensuring only one version of your website is accessible to both users and search engine crawlers.

Page Speed Optimization

Improving your page speed is crucial for effective technical SEO. A faster-loading website not only enhances user experience but also positively impacts search engine rankings. Swift page load times contribute to lower bounce rates, higher user engagement, and improved conversion rates. Search engines, such as Google, prioritize faster sites, considering them more user-friendly. Optimize images, leverage browser caching, and minimize HTTP requests to boost your website’s speed. Prioritize mobile optimization and utilize content delivery networks (CDNs) to ensure swift access across devices and locations. In summary, prioritizing page speed is a fundamental aspect of technical SEO, yielding benefits in both user satisfaction and search engine visibility.

Canonicalization

Canonicalization is the process by which Google selects and indexes one version of a page among multiple available versions. The chosen URL, known as the canonical URL, is the one displayed in Google search results. Google employs various signals to determine the canonical URL, including canonical tags, identification of duplicate pages, analysis of internal links, consideration of redirects, and evaluation of Sitemap URLs.

To assess how Google has indexed a page, the URL Inspection tool in Google Search Console proves invaluable. This tool reveals the canonical URL selected by Google.

Mobile Friendliness

Ensuring your website is mobile-friendly is paramount for effective SEO. With the growing dominance of mobile users, search engines prioritize mobile-friendly sites in their rankings. Google, for instance, utilizes mobile-first indexing, meaning it primarily uses the mobile version of a site for indexing and ranking. A mobile-friendly design enhances user experience, reduces bounce rates, and contributes to higher search engine rankings. Employ responsive design principles, optimize images for mobile devices, and streamline content for smaller screens. Prioritizing mobile-friendliness not only caters to the preferences of modern users but also aligns with search engine algorithms, boosting your website’s visibility in search results.
